I have a trip coming up and plan on taking a few rods & reels with me. What type of rod tube do you use, have you used, or would you suggest? I have been looking at the Plano rod tube (model no. 4588). But, the reviews on Basspro were pretty bad. I will be transporting three or four two piece rods. The rods will be taken apart for transport too.

Suggestions?

Visit the hardware store and get a length of pvc tubing in diameter and length desired and a couple end caps.

I bought the Bazooka Pro, holds 12 rods and was CHEEEEEAP.  I think it was $44.  It locks, is lighter than PVC and is easy to carry with the handle/strap combo. (keep this in mind when it's time to walk through an airport with all your stuff)

It's lightweight

It locks

Once you have one, you'll have it for the next trip also.

It has plenty of room.  Even if you take only 4 rods, get the big one, you pack clothing around and in between all your rods so they stays nice and safe.  This also leaves room in your suitcase for more tackle!!
